Gravitons and the Drell-Hearn-Gerasimov Sum Rule

Haim Goldberg

hep-pharXiv:hep-ph/9904318

Abstract

One-loop diagrams containing a graviton provide a finite contribution to the anomalous magnetic moment of a lepton, whether or not the graviton propagates in n large extra compact dimensions. In the present work, the tree graph photoproduction of a graviton, integrated up to an arbitrary cutoff, is shown to violate the Drell-Hearn-Gerasimov sum rule for 2. The possibility of resurrecting the sum rule from high energy contributions originating in string excitations is discussed in a qualitative manner, and various problems associated with such a program are pointed out.
